We also tested the drive in a number of workload scenarios that it might face in real life. The IOMeter settings we used to test with are listed below, each test being run for 10 minutes:-

Database Server
Transfer Size: 8K Reads: 67% Writes: 33% Random: 100%
Boundary: 4K Outstanding IO: 128 Threads: 4

Exchange Email 4K
Transfer Size: 4K Reads: 67% Writes: 33% Random: 100%
Boundary: 4K Outstanding IO: 128 Threads: 4

Exchange Email 8K
Transfer Size: 8K Reads: 67% Writes: 33% Random: 100%
Boundary: 8K Outstanding IO: 64 Threads: 4

Exchange Email 32K
Transfer Size: 32K Reads: 67% Writes: 33% Random: 100%
Boundary: 4K Outstanding IO: 128 Threads: 4

Media Streaming
Transfer Size: 64K Reads: 98% Writes: 2% Sequential: 100%
Boundary: 4K Outstanding IO: 64 Threads: 8

Search Engine A
Transfer Size: 4K Reads: 100% Writes: 0% Random: 100%
Boundary: 4K Outstanding IO: 128 Threads: 8

Search Engine B
Transfer Size: 8K Reads: 100% Writes: 0% Random: 100%
Boundary: 4K Outstanding IO: 128 Threads: 8

Web File Server 4KB
Transfer Size: 8K Reads: 95% Writes: 5% Random: 75%
Boundary: 4K Outstanding IO: 32 Threads: 8

Web File Server 8KB
Transfer Size: 8K Reads: 95% Writes: 5% Random: 75%
Boundary: 4K Outstanding IO: 64 Threads: 8

Web File Server 64KB
Transfer Size: 64K Reads: 95% Writes 5% Random: 75%
Boundary: 4K Outstanding IO: 64 Threads: 8

Web Server Log
Transfer Size: 8K Reads: 0% Writes: 100% Random: 100%
Boundary: 4K Outstanding IO: 128 Threads: 4

Video On Demand
Transfer Size: 512K Reads: 100% Writes: 0% Random: 100%
Boundary: 4K Outstanding IO: 64 Threads: 8

As you might expect for a drive designed to handle most of these scenarios in one way or another, the DC3000ME tackles these tests very efficiently with some very strong bandwidth figures. Although we can't really compare the performance of the DC3000ME to the other data centre/enterprise drives we tested because the test platform was completely different, these test results are by far the fastest we've seen with this class of drive (e.g. the Kingston DC1500M produced a Search Engine A test result of 438,233 IOPS, the DC3000ME, 837,260 IOPS).
